A new video game based on the iconic anime series Patlabor is set to debut on PC and PlayStation 5 later this year. The announcement shocked the gaming community, sparking mixed reactions about its visuals and gameplay mechanics.
Fans of Patlabor reacted sharply to the surprise news. Many expressed enthusiasm, with one user declaring, "Day one buy!" However, others voiced concerns about the game's appearance and development quality. A frequent comment highlighted the fear associated with mid-budget titles, stating, "My sense of dread rises every time I see the Unreal Engine logo for a mid-budget game."
Numerous comments shared skepticism regarding the game's graphics and combat mechanics. One user bluntly assessed, "Dude, Iโm gonna be so honest this game looks like shit," expressing disappointment about the game's animation quality.
Noting the lack of impact in combat animations, another pointed out, "You can tell the game devs donโt have an appreciation for guns or complex machinery in the same way that the animators did."
Interestingly, many fans remember the last Patlabor title released for PS1 and PSP. One remarked, "What a genuine surprise!" This underscores the nostalgic connection to the franchise that many still hold.
